– If you were hoping to see Becky Lynch and Trish Stratus at SummerSlam, we have some bad news.

On this week’s episode of RAW, Becky defeated Trish via DQ after Zoey Stark interfered.

In a backstage segment after the match, Adam Pearce told Trish that will she face Becky again in 2 weeks, and banned Zoey from ringside.

This means that this highly awaited match won’t take place at this Saturday’s SummerSlam 2023 premium live event.

It will instead take place on the August 14th episode of RAW in Canada.

According to Fightful Select, the original plan for Trish vs. Becky III was to take place at SummerSlam, but it got changed over the weekend.

There were some discussions to postpone it until the Payback premium live event on September 2nd, but then the decision was made to do it in Canada in Trish’s home country.

– World Heavyweight Champion Seth Rollins is a big fan of the NFL and shows his support for the Chicago Bears every year during the football season.

Many wrestlers in WWE have transitioned from being NFL players to pro wrestlers over the years. Rollins, on the other hand, wants to make the jump from WWE to NFL after he retires from wrestling, but he wants to work as an analyst.

Speaking to Sports Illustrated, The Visionary spoke about his passion for the NFL:

“I would love [to be an NFL analyst]. Any chance we get to talk about football. I am all about it.

Obviously I’ve got ways to go [in wrestling]. I’m hitting my prime right now, just hitting my stride, I got some time, but I would love to parlay into working with the NFL in some capacity.

I’m just such a fan and it’s one of my only other real passions that I have time for. If anybody wants to have me on their show… I would love it.”
